Klien baris perintah SVN: checkout ditolak ketika kata sandi LDAP mengubah "svn: OPTIONS of" (repo) "otorisasi gagal" (tetapi bekerja di TortoiseSVN)

0

Saat menggunakan klien baris perintah / terminal svn, kolega mendapatkan "svn: OPSI dari" [repo] "... otorisasi gagal" pesan galat ketika mereka mencoba untuk checkout repo menjadi copy pekerjaan lokal mereka.

Mereka dulu bisa melakukan ini tetapi baru-baru ini harus mengubah kata sandi mereka (kebijakan keamanan rutin berkala). Dan itu berhenti bekerja. CATATAN: Perintah pemeriksaan svn memang meminta kata sandi setiap kali (yang mereka berikan - yaitu yang baru.)

TAPI anehnya mereka tidak punya masalah dengan Tortoise SVN, itu berhasil. Mereka menyediakan login biasa dan kata sandi baru dan berfungsi.

Pengaturan kami adalah mesin CentOS Linux tervirtualisasi dengan beberapa akun pengguna Linux tempat pengembangan berlangsung dan repo sentral SVN berada di server terpisah, otentikasi menggunakan login LDAP kami (yaitu login perusahaan yang sama yang digunakan untuk login ke mesin Windows kami). Kami masuk sebagai pengguna Linux ke server pengembangan kami dari mesin Windows kami, menggunakan alat SSH terminal standar, misalnya Putty atau MobaXTerm atau CygWin.

Ketika saya mengubah kata sandi saya, saya tidak mendapatkan masalah yang sama, saya dapat checkout.

Saya telah melihat banyak pertanyaan tentang pesan kesalahan ini dari mencari berbagai forum di google tetapi belum ada yang memberi saya solusi.

Salah satu solusi yang saya temukan menyarankan untuk menghapus atau menghapus cache lokal yang mengandung otentikasi, dalam .subversionfolder, kami mencoba ini tetapi masih masalah yang sama. Juga mencoba memeriksa ke folder lain.

Jadi sepertinya kami telah membersihkan jejak kata sandi yang di-cache tetapi masih menolak.

  • Mungkinkah ada tempat lain di mesin CentOS Linux kami yang melakukan cache login
  • Apa yang dimaksud dengan PILIHAN (mungkinkah itu pengaturan di suatu tempat di mesin pengembangan kami atau di server repo SVN?)
  • Mungkinkah itu cache Proksi HTTP dari kredensial kolega saya yang disimpan di suatu tempat - jadi kita perlu menghapusnya ketika kata sandi diubah?
therobyouknow
sumber
TUTUP di sini dan pindah ke programmers.stackexchange.com (ini adalah pertanyaan pengembangan daripada masalah pengguna - yang SU berurusan dengan)
therobyouknow
Tampaknya tidak ada apa pun dalam pertanyaan ini yang berkaitan dengan pemrograman, ini adalah pertanyaan tentang perangkat lunak.
Paul
@ Paul bekerja dengan SVN (Subversion) biasanya melibatkan bekerja dengan kode - yaitu pemrograman, karena SVN adalah tentang kontrol versi dan digunakan untuk mengontrol versi kode sumber yang digunakan untuk menghasilkan perangkat lunak. Yang mengatakan, SVN dapat digunakan untuk mengontrol jenis file, bukan hanya perangkat lunak: dokumentasi, file media, dll. Tetapi aktivitas menggunakan SVN lebih merupakan aktivitas pengembangan dan karenanya harus dimiliki oleh programmer.se daripada superuser yang berhubungan dengan pengguna (termasuk daya) pengguna komputer, aplikasi dan OS mereka.
therobyouknow
@therobyouknow kita menggunakan SVN sebagai sistem kontrol dokumen serta versi perangkat lunak. Itu tidak hanya digunakan oleh pengembang ... Dan hanya karena mungkin muat di situs Stack lain tidak berarti secara otomatis harus dimigrasi. Saya tidak melihat ada masalah dengan tinggal di sini. Jika di sisi lain Anda ingin pindah, Anda dapat menandai pertanyaan Anda dan meminta mod untuk memindahkannya untuk Anda.
Mokubai